在区块链和加密货币的世界里,安全性是极其重要的。冷钱包是最常用的一种存储加密货币的方式,它被认为是存储...
随着区块链技术的迅猛发展和数字资产的普及,多签钱包(Multisignature Wallet)作为一种提高资产安全性的工具,逐渐走入大众视野。多签钱包通过要求多个密钥共同签署交易来增强账户安全,减少因单点故障造成的资产损失。然而,尽管多签钱包具有更高的安全性,但它并非无懈可击,也蕴含着一些潜在的安全隐患。本文将深入探讨多签钱包的安全隐患以及相应的解决方案,并将提供一系列相关问题的详细解答。
#### 多签钱包的工作原理多签钱包的核心是一个合约,设置了特定数量的签名来验证一笔交易的合法性。通常表示为“M of N”,即需要N个密钥中的M个才能完成交易。例如,一个2-3的多签钱包意味着需要3把秘钥中的2把来签署交易。这种机制明显提高了资产管理的安全性,尤其是在团队或组织中,因为即使某一钥匙被盗,黑客也无法单独转移资产。
### 多签钱包的安全隐患 #### 1. 签名密钥的管理尽管多签钱包减少了单点故障的风险,但密钥的管理本身仍是一大挑战。如果签名密钥存放不当,仍然可能导致资产被盗。特别是在团队合作中,密钥的分发和管理需谨慎处理。遗失或泄露任何一把密钥,都可能使整个钱包面临安全风险。
#### 2. 越权问题多签钱包虽然要求多个密钥进行交易,但如果没有设定有效的权限控制,团队中的某些高管或发展人员可能会拥有过高的授权能力。团队成员可能在没有其他成员同意的情况下,随意创建新的密钥或更改现有的管理设置,在权力过度集中时,容易造成资产损失。
#### 3. 私钥备份许多用户在使用多签钱包时,忘记了对私钥进行系统性的备份。如果在系统崩溃或用户误删除密钥时,备份不完整可能导致无法访问钱包中持有的资产。无论是什么级别的加密货币钱包,私钥的安全和备份都是重中之重。
#### 4. 智能合约漏洞多签钱包通常依赖智能合约的实现,而智能合约的代码若存在漏洞,将导致其被攻击者利用,从而造成资产损失。因此,确保智能合约的代码经过充分审核和调试是必要的步骤。
#### 5. 社交工程攻击黑客可能通过社交工程的方式,试图影响团队中的某个成员,获得其密钥的访问权限。这种攻击在多签钱包场景中同样具有破坏性,尤其是在团队协作较多的情况下,团队成员之间的信息保密和个人安全意识显得尤为重要。
### 解决安全隐患的方案 #### 1. 加强密钥管理团队在使用多签钱包时,务必要制定一个完善的密钥管理策略。建议采用以下措施:
设置权限控制机制,在多签钱包中实施最小权限原则。确保任何成员不具备单独改变设置的能力,所有操作需经过团队内部确认和审批。
#### 3. 定期备份与恢复测试非常重要的一点是,定期备份私钥,并进行恢复测试。这意味着用户应定期检查其备份是否有效,以避免恶性事件时无钥可用的局面。
#### 4. 智能合约的代码审核选择一个经过审计的多签钱包合约,可以大大减少合约漏洞带来的风险。此外,建议使用开源钱包方案,这样社区能够共同对代码进行审核,及时发现潜在的安全隐患。
#### 5. 增强社交工程防范意识对团队成员进行安全意识培训,使他们了解社交工程攻击的风险和识别技巧。定期进行模拟钓鱼攻击,以提升团队成员对安全风险的感知。
### 常见问题解答 #### 多签钱包相比传统钱包有哪些优势?多签钱包相比传统钱包具备以下优势:
这种优势适合希望对数字资产进行精细化管理的团队或公司,能够有效防止内部或外部的恶意行为,确保资产的安全。
#### 如何选择合适的多签钱包?选择多签钱包时,请遵循以下步骤:
通过这些标准的评估,用户可以建立一个既符合安全需求又能够提供操作便利的多签钱包。
#### 多签钱包失效后,资产如何恢复?如果多签钱包出现故障,用户需要尽早采取措施进行恢复:
在此过程中,务必保持冷静,并尽量避免因慌乱而造成的进一步损失。用户也要在平时关注备份的重要性,确保避免经济损失。
#### 如何防范账户遭到黑客攻击?在使用多签钱包的过程中,用户可以采取以下措施以防范黑客攻击:
通过这些综合性的措施,用户可以更好地保护多签钱包,降低因黑客攻击造成的风险。
#### 多签钱包的使用场景有哪些?多签钱包可以广泛应用于多个场景,包括:
通过这些应用场景的实际使用,可以见到多签钱包所具备的灵活性和安全性,能够帮助用户在多种情况下有效管理资产。
### 结论多签钱包为用户提供了一个更加安全和灵活的数字资产管理方式,但与此同时,它的有效使用也伴随着一定的安全隐患。我们需要时刻保持警惕,不断学习和安全管理措施,以达到增强资产保护的目标。在探索区块链技术的过程中,加强安全意识,才能够让我们更好地享受数字资产带来的便利。